Would have been a great question, if time constraints were there.
Test | Status | Code Input and Output |
---|---|---|
1 | Pass |
a = [1 0; 0 0];
[r1,r2,c1,c2] = biggest_box(a);
sub = a(r1:r2,c1:c2);
[m,n] = size(sub);
len = 1;
assert(isequal(sum(sub(:)),0))
assert(isequal(m,len));
assert(isequal(n,len));
r1 =
1
r2 =
1
|
2 | Pass |
a = [1 0 0; 0 0 0; 0 0 0];
[r1,r2,c1,c2] = biggest_box(a);
sub = a(r1:r2,c1:c2);
[m,n] = size(sub);
len = 2;
assert(isequal(sum(sub(:)),0))
assert(isequal(m,len));
assert(isequal(n,len));
r1 =
1
r2 =
2
|
3 | Pass |
a = eye(9);
[r1,r2,c1,c2] = biggest_box(a);
sub = a(r1:r2,c1:c2);
[m,n] = size(sub);
len = 4;
assert(isequal(sum(sub(:)),0))
assert(isequal(m,len));
assert(isequal(n,len));
r1 =
1
r2 =
4
|
4 | Pass |
a = double(magic(7)<6);
[r1,r2,c1,c2] = biggest_box(a);
sub = a(r1:r2,c1:c2);
[m,n] = size(sub);
len = 4;
assert(isequal(sum(sub(:)),0))
assert(isequal(m,len));
assert(isequal(n,len));
r1 =
2
r2 =
5
|
594 Solvers
519 Solvers
Back to basics 12 - Input Arguments
525 Solvers
1143 Solvers
450 Solvers
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!